The game is described as an RPG where you are the captain of a single ship traveling around a galaxy, populated by alien races and factions that are playing a 4X game. Factions will declare war on each other, sign treaties, and territories will constantly shift and change as the galaxy goes about their business, regardless- or because of- your intervention. Accept quests, negotiate with the various factions, and upgrade your ship with new weapons and components. You can even team up with a friend in online co-op.

Somewhere between Diablo and The Last Federation. Fly around killing generic pirates for a while, collect loot, and then eventually aid one of the factions. In the background, all the factions are playing a mini-4x game that you can influence by completing quests or just massacring the faction fleets. These factions research and improve where you can't, so picking the one making the parts you want for your ship is an interesting "specialization" choice with real ramifications and investment.
My main issues with it are it's ugly as orange piss and very stingy on bag space at the beginning. As such you have to push through the bad early game to start getting to the fun stuff. But once it clicks it's quite enjoyable!
